By default, the Windows XP and Vista systems will try to synchronize your computer's time with an Internet Time Server on a weekly basis.
The Internet Time Update application was designed to be a small utility that will allow you to change the interval (frequency) between Internet Time Updates.
You can choose from weekly, daily, hourly settings. Download the ZIP file and extract the contents to your hard drive. The EXE file you extracted is the program. There is no install/uninstall.
NOTE:
You MUST have Administrator level privileges to use this utility.
Requirements:
· Net Framework v2.00 is required to run this utility.
